Psychological Thriller “Mother, May I?” Streaming Just in Time for Halloween

The psychological thriller Mother, May I? is now available for streaming on Amazon Prime Video, just in time for Halloween. This film, described as a “must-watch” and “quietly devastating,” stars Kyle Gallner and Holland Roden. It follows the story of Emmett (played by Gallner), who confronts his troubled relationship with his mother after her death. He travels to her home with his girlfriend, Anya (Roden), only to find that Anya begins to behave strangely, as if possessed by the spirit of Emmett’s deceased mother.

Critically acclaimed, Mother, May I? boasts an impressive 84% rating on Rotten Tomatoes. Reviewers have highlighted the compelling performances and the film’s intricate narrative structure. It first premiered at the Fantasy Filmfest in April 2023 and later received a cinema release in July, garnering positive feedback from both critics and audiences.

Critical Reception and Themes

The film has attracted significant attention, with media outlets like the Los Angeles Times noting its aesthetic appeal and depth: “It’s a handsome-looking ghost story about a man who was haunted by his mother even when she was alive.” The Guardian acknowledged some shortcomings in the film’s final act but praised the strong performances by Gallner and Roden, stating there is “an immense amount of craft on display.”

Cultured Vultures described the film as featuring “thoughtful and sensitive performances” that elevate the viewing experience. Similarly, Bloody Disgusting remarked on the film’s slow-burning tension and visual richness, emphasizing the emotional weight carried by its lead actors. Paste Magazine further emphasized the authenticity of the performances, calling them “authentically, vulnerably, fantastically acted.”

Gallner discussed his motivation for participating in the film during an interview with Filmhounds Magazine. He expressed intrigue in the supernatural elements and the psychological complexities that arise when Anya embodies his mother. “He’s coming face-to-face with his trauma, and you don’t know what’s real and what’s not,” Gallner explained. He also highlighted the couple’s struggle with their future, adding layers of anxiety to their relationship.
